- 根据PolarDB官方文档创建一个数据库集群,并设置白名单为ECS IP.
- 然后在ECS上使用LAMP一键安装,安装的时候选择MySQL5.7版本的数据库.
- 通过git下载PbootCM的源码并放到Apache的wwwroot目录下,并对这些文件加上所有人都可以写的权限.
然后导入CMS的初始数据:
$ sql_file="/var/www/html/static/backup/sql/"$(ls /var/www/html/static/backup/sql/) &&
mysql -h数据库连接地址 -utest_user -pPassword1213 -Dpbootcms < $sql_file
- 修改CMS的数据库配置,使用PolarDB数据库:
$ cat > /var/www/html/config/database.php << EOF
<?php
return array(
'database' => array(
'type' => 'mysqli', // 数据库连接驱动类型: mysqli,sqlite,pdo_mysql,pdo_sqlite
'host' => '数据库连接地址', // PolarDB数据库链接地址
'user' => 'test_user', // PolarDB数据库的用户名
'passwd' => 'Password1213', // PolarDB数据库的密码
'port' => '3306', // 数据库端口
'dbname' => 'pbootcms' //数据库名称
)
);
EOF
- 在ECS控制台上开放80端口,然后重启apache服务,即可通过ECS IP访问到该门户网站.